Are there chances for spouse visa cases in Australia or New Zealand given the budget constraints?
Yes, you can apply for a spouse visa in both Australia and New Zealand even with budget constraints, as long as you meet each country's financial requirements.
- Australia: The Partner Visa requires evidence of a genuine relationship and financial stability, but there is no fixed minimum income. The main applicant fee is AUD 11,710 (subject to change). Showing joint finances and the sponsor's stable income strengthens your case.
- New Zealand: The Partner of a New Zealander Work Visa also focuses on proof of a stable relationship and ability to support yourselves. The main applicant fee is NZD 1,500 (subject to change). Joint finances and shared living arrangements are important.
Both countries expect you to demonstrate you can support yourselves. If your budget is limited, providing clear evidence of joint finances and a detailed budget can help.
